    Hi @Mike

    The phone and iPad are very easy to figure out as they typically are around the same Watt hours regardless of what brand phone you get. The main concern here is the collar and transmitter as I do not have a estimated amount of Watt hours for the batteries of each. Looking at the size of the items, we could take a guess but it could be a very inaccurate. With phone, tablet and the two other devices the Yeti 200X would probably be the best option. The Yeti 200X will be able to give you at least two charges to each device if you charge all of them daily. If you get a solar panel such as the Nomad 50 panel, then you will be able to charge the Yeti daily as well and as long as you have good sun, the Yeti will give give you several charges to each devices without running out of power.
